/* CSS Document */

body {
	text-align:center;
	margin:0px; font-family:Microsoft YaHei; font-size:12px;
}
div {
	text-align:left;
	margin:0px auto;
}
a:link {
	color:#000000;
	text-decoration:none;
}
a:visited {
	color:#000000;
	text-decoration:none;
}
a:hover {
	color:#f00;
	text-decoration:none;
}
.zong {
	width:1000px;
	height:auto;
}
.top {
	width:1000px;
	height:79px;
	float:left;
}
.logo {
	width:700px;
	height:79px;
	float:left;
}
.daoh { width:100%; height:37px;background-image:url(images/dh1.gif); line-height:37px; font-size:16px; color:#F00; font-weight:bold;}
.right2 { float:right;  height:15px; padding-right:10px; padding-top:12px;}
.right3 { float:right;  height:15px; }
.daoh1 { width:100%; height:37px;background-image:url(images/dh1.gif); line-height:37px; border-bottom:1px solid #999; font-size:16px; color:#F00; font-weight:bold;}

.newss { float:left; width:100%; font-size:12px; margin-top:5px; height:26px; line-height:26px; text-indent:10px;color: #666;}

.newss a:link {
	color: #666;
}
.newss a:visited {
	color: #666;
}
.newss a:hover {
	color: #666;
}
.newss a:active {
	color: #666;
}

.fywz { float:left; width:100%;height:auto;  text-align:left;  line-height:30px; font-size:13px; padding-top:10px;
}
.fynr { width:96%; height:auto; margin:2% auto;}
.fytp { float:left; width:210px; height:294px; margin:10px;text-align:center; line-height:30px; }
.fytp1 { float:left; width:208px; height:230px; margin-left:5px; margin-bottom:10px; text-align:center; line-height:20px;}
.fanye { float:left; width:100%; height:30px; line-height:30px; margin-top:20px; font-size:12px; color:#666; text-align:center;text-decoration:none;}
.fanye a{ color:#666; text-decoration:none;}
.ming {float:left; width:100%; height:50px; line-height:50px; font-size:16px; font-weight:bold;color:#000; text-align:center;}












.yemei {
	width:244px;
	height:20px;
	float:left;
	background-image:url(images/ym.gif);
	background-position:top;
	background-repeat:no-repeat;
	padding:5px 0px 0px 25px; font-size:12px;
}
.yemei a {
	width:70px;
	height:15px;
	float:left;
	font-size:12px;
	text-align:center;
	border-right:1px solid #FFFFFF;
	
}
.yemei a:link {
	color:#FFFFFF;
}
.yemei a:visited {
	color:#FFFFFF;
}
.yemei a:hover {
	color:#000000;
}
.banner {
	width:1000px;
	height:270px;
	float:left;
}
.daohang {
	width:970px;
	height:22px;
	float:left;
	background-image:url(images/dh.gif);
	background-position:left;
	background-repeat:repeat-x;
	padding:8px 0px 0px 30px;
}
.daohang a {
	width:100px;
	height:auto;
	float:left;
	font-size:14px;
	text-align:center;
	border-right:1px solid #FFFFFF;
}
.daohang a:link {
	color:#FFFFFF;
}
.daohang a:visited {
	color:#FFFFFF;
}
.daohang a:hover {
	color:#f00;
}
.news {
	width:490px;
	height:303px;
	float:left;
	border:1px solid #bbdcfc; margin-top:10px; margin-left:5px;
}
.fynews {
	width:265px;
	height:303px;
	float:left;
	border:1px solid #bbdcfc; margin-top:10px; margin-left:5px;
}
.gsjj {
	width:678px;
	height:303px;
	float:left;
	border:1px solid #bbdcfc; margin-left:5px;
}
.gsjj label {
	width:181px;
	height:246px;
	float:left; margin-left:3px;
}
.gsjj span {
	width:450px;
	height:240px;
	float:left;
	font-size:12px;
	line-height:25px;
	padding-left:10px; padding-top:15px;
}
.lxwm {
	width:300px;
	height:268px;
	float:left;
	font-size:12px;
	line-height:24px;
	background-image:url(images/lxwm.gif);
	background-repeat:no-repeat;
	margin-left:5px;
	padding:40px 0px 0px 10px;
}
.cpzs {
	width:990px;
	height:auto;
	float:left;
	padding:20px 5px 0px 5px;
}
.cpzsBT {
	width:980px;
	height:30px;
	float:left;
	background-image:url(images/cpzs.gif);
	background-position:left;
	background-repeat:repeat-x;
	padding:3px 0px 0px 10px;
}
.cpzsNR {
	width:988px;
	height:468px;
	float:left;
	border-bottom:1px #0053b1 solid;
	border-left:1px #0053b1 solid;
	border-right:1px #0053b1 solid;
	border-top:3px #0053b1 solid;
}
.cpzsNR a {
	display:inline;
	width:168px;
	height:220px;
	float:left;
	font-size:14px;
	text-align:center;
	line-height:25px;
	margin:10px 0px 0px 24px;
}
.cpzsNR a:link img {
	border:2px solid #d5d2d2;
}
.cpzsNR a:visited img {
	border:2px solid #d5d2d2;
}
.cpzsNR a:hover img {
	border:2px solid #0066FF;
}
.bottom {
	width:1000px;
	height:128px;
	float:left;
	font-size:12px;
	color:#FFFFFF;
	text-align:center;
	line-height:22px;
	background-color:#1b83da;
	border-top:2px solid #005eeb;
	margin-top:35px;
	padding-top:10px;
}
.bottom a:link {
	color: #FFFFFF;
	text-decoration:none;
}
.bottom a:visited {
	color:#FFFFFF;
	text-decoration:none;
}
.bottom a:hover {
	color:#f00;
	text-decoration:none;
}
.lxwmFY {
	width:265px;
	height:389px;
	float:left;
	border:2px solid #bbdcfc;
	margin-top:20px;
}
.lxwmFY label {
	width:255px;
	height:auto;
	float:left;
	font-size:12px;
	line-height:25px;
	padding:10px 0px 0px 10px;
}
.right {
	width:705px;
	height:auto;
	float:left;
	border:2px solid #bbdcfc;
	margin-left:15px;
}
.right label {
	width:705px;
	height:84px;
	float:left;
	text-align:center;
	font-size:20px;
	font-weight:bold;
	color:#FF0000;
	line-height:84px;
	background-image:url(images/right.gif);
	background-position:center;
	background-repeat:no-repeat;
}
































